What You’ll Bring Required BS in environmental science, biology, natural resources, or a related discipline (minimum 3.0 GPA), or equivalent experience. 3+ years of experience (5 years strongly preferred) in environmental consulting or related field. Technical Skills: Wetland delineation using the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ers Wetlands Delineation Manual and Regional Supplements. Plant identification, soil sampling, hydric soil indicators, and hydrology field assessment. Strong data management and technical report writing capabilities. Other Requirements: Driver's License Required: This position requires a valid driver's license and/or the ability to operate a company vehicle due to the nature of job duties, which include frequent travel to various client locations across a large geographical area. Ability to travel up to 75%. Proficiency in Microsoft Office. Strong communication, analytical, and problem‑solving skills. Ability to work independently and collaboratively in dynamic field and project environments. This position is not eligible for immigration sponsorship. Preferred Professional Wetland Certificate (nationwide) and experience working in the Midwest. Experience with NEPA environmental assessments, permitting, and compliance documentation. Familiarity with U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service, National Marine Fisheries Service, and state/local regulatory requirements. Key Responsibilities Perform wetland delineations across Upper Midwest states using federal and regional protocols. Conduct habitat assessments, environmental due diligence, and NEPA‑related impact analysis. Prepare multi‑media environmental permitting materials and compliance management plans. Support project delivery through field surveys, data interpretation, literature reviews, and technical reporting. Collaborate with cross‑functional teams to develop recommendations and strategic solutions for clients. Manage quality, budgets, and timelines in alignment with ERM’s Impact Assessment team objectives.
